Actually snapshots, per ALPA merger policy, are taken at the PID which is the date the merger is either consummated or likely to be consummated. There has not been a PID established yet, but a betting man would do well if they said Date of Corporate Closure (DCC) would be the PID and trigger the snapshot. Nu you forget that the DOJ hasn't even approved this merger yet. How on earth do you think a snapshot has been taken?

From the ALPA merger policy:

1. Policy Initiation Date (PID) means the date on which the respective MEC Chairmen and the Executive Council determine that a reasonable probability of a merger being consummated exists or the date on which the Executive Council determines that a reasonable probability of a merger being consummated exists, whichever is earlier. Seniority list integration procedures will commence on the Policy Initiation Date. (AMENDED - Executive Board May 1998)
